I have a some deployment scenarios when the customer does not what the Windows Store App on the Task bar on Windows 10.
I have found this GPO settings to remove the store App from the Task bar with out chancing the functionality of the Windows Store.
Create a User GPO
Change the settings: User Configuration -> Administrative Templates -> Start Menu and Taskbar -> Do not allow pinning Store app to the Taskbar

Enable the setting

Deploy the GPO for the users
The Windows Store App is removed from the Task Bar

The Windows Store is still in the Start Layout

It is not possible to Pin the Windows Store to the Task bar again

And the Windows Store App is still working 🙂


Worked like a charm, much obliged.